Highland Park High School Local Area Guide
Event & Visitor Overview – Highland Park High School
Highland Park High School hosts a mix of scholastic athletics, school ceremonies, and community youth events. Typical uses include varsity and junior varsity football, soccer, baseball/softball, track meets, and indoor gym sports during colder months, along with occasional band performances and commencement ceremonies. Visitors tend to be families, students, coaches, and local supporters; coaches and referees are regular weekday attendees while families and alumni assemble for weekend contests and important Friday-night or weekend varsity matchups. Trips are usually organized around game schedules, school calendars, and multi-team tournament brackets when those are held on site.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
Event days often follow a layered schedule: morning or early-afternoon youth or club matches can lead into evening high-school varsity contests, and multi-team tournaments commonly use staggered match times through the day. Pre-game warmups and team stretches occupy the hour before play, then a pronounced arrival of spectators builds as the main contest approaches. Between games there is usually downtime for player rotations, brief warmups, and scoreboard updates; after the final match most families and teams depart in waves rather than all at once, while post-game gatherings among players and coaches are common for debriefs or quick celebrations.
Getting thereTravel & Arrival Patterns
Most attendees arrive by car from the surrounding suburban and regional area, with the majority travelling the same day for weekday practices and arriving earlier on big game days. Visiting squads and families from farther away sometimes arrive the night before for tournament play or playoff rounds, which reduces morning congestion. Expect concentrated pre-event arrivals and a sharp surge after final whistles; volunteers and staff typically manage flow, but choosing a staggered arrival or early entry helps avoid peak congestion. Fly-in visitors are rare; regional driving patterns dominate for this level of competition.
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
Seasonal swings affect comfort and equipment: cold, windy, and occasionally snowy conditions in late fall and winter make layered clothing, hand warmers, and waterproof outerwear useful for spectators and players on sidelines, while spring can bring damp, muddy fields and sporadic rain delays that require quick access to rain gear. Summer and early-fall practices and camps often involve warm, humid afternoons where sun protection and hydration are important. For evening events, plan for cooling temperatures after sunset and for organizers to allow buffer time for weather-related delays during transitional seasons.
